drm/i915: Rename priotree to sched



Having moved the priotree struct into i915_scheduler.h, identify it as
the scheduling element and rebrand into i915_sched. This becomes more
useful as we start attaching more information we require to propagate
through the scheduler.

v2: Use i915_sched_node for future distinctiveness
